上一页 1 2 3 4 5 6 ··· 23 下一页
摘要: 安全编译: NX(堆栈不可执行): -z noexecstack SP(栈保护):-fstack-protector-all 或 -fstack-protector-strong BIND_NOW(立即绑定):-Wl,z,now 或 LD_BIND_NOW=1 RELRO(只读重定位):-Wl,-z 阅读全文
posted @ 2021-02-06 17:54 cs_wu 阅读(1656) 评论(0) 推荐(0) 编辑
摘要: 需求:golang生成秘钥对,秘钥有密码 package main import ( "crypto/rand" "crypto/rsa" "crypto/x509" "encoding/pem" "fmt" "os" ) func generateRSAKey(pripath, pubpath, 阅读全文
posted @ 2021-02-06 17:39 cs_wu 阅读(1496) 评论(0) 推荐(0) 编辑
摘要: 一、select简介 1.Go的select语句是一种仅能用于channl发送和接收消息的专用语句,此语句运行期间是阻塞的;当select中没有case语句的时候,会阻塞当前groutine。 2.select是Golang在语言层面提供的I/O多路复用的机制,其专门用来检测多个channel是否准 阅读全文
posted @ 2020-11-01 18:52 cs_wu 阅读(4938) 评论(0) 推荐(1) 编辑
摘要: 准备: 准备一个U盘 下载centos镜像 下载uiso9_cn,用于把 镜像写入U盘 开始: 启动PC机,按F12进入BIOS(各个牌子的电脑进入BIOS可能不一样),然后点击USB,后续的安装跟正常的安装系统一样这里就不重复说了,网上教程很多。 接下来说一下怎么连接WIFI,首先是用ip add 阅读全文
posted @ 2020-10-03 16:36 cs_wu 阅读(815) 评论(0) 推荐(0) 编辑
摘要: demo示例: aplugin.go package main func Add(x, y int) int { return x + y } func Subtract(x, y int) int { return x - y } 创建插件aplugin.so : go build -buildm 阅读全文
posted @ 2020-09-10 20:22 cs_wu 阅读(1693) 评论(0) 推荐(0) 编辑
摘要: 作为一个软件开发工程师,相信大家经常会遇到设备上的程序有bug需要修改,但是因为程序年代太久远或源码分支太多,已经没办法知道设备上的程序是在哪一个提交里编译出来的,这时候查问题是非常困难的。如果没法确定设备上程序对应的代码分支,我们能做的就是给设备升级到最新版本,如果新旧版本和设备之间是兼容的那还好 阅读全文
posted @ 2020-08-04 21:29 cs_wu 阅读(2045) 评论(0) 推荐(0) 编辑
摘要: C语言 字节数组和hex和互相转换 #include<iostream> #include<string.h> #include<stdio.h> //字节流转换为十六进制字符串 void ByteToHexStr(const unsigned char* source, char* dest, i 阅读全文
posted @ 2020-06-21 21:57 cs_wu 阅读(7206) 评论(0) 推荐(0) 编辑
摘要: 转载地址:https://blog.csdn.net/ky_heart/article/details/53048692 常见的数据校验方法 1. 校验是什么 校验,是为保护数据的完整性,用一种指定的算法对原始数据计算出的一个校验值。当接收方用同样的算法再算一次校验值,如果两次校验值一样,表示数据完 阅读全文
posted @ 2020-04-16 21:44 cs_wu 阅读(3612) 评论(0) 推荐(0) 编辑
摘要: C++对一些常见的类型转换有库函数可用,对一些不是很常见的数据类型就没有类型转换的库函数可用了,很多时候转换起来非常麻烦。这里用C++的输入输出流的方法来做数据类型转换(这种方法本质上其实是把数据输出到缓存中然后再去读取,这个流的缓存数据是没有类型的,所以就能把xx类型的数据赋值给yy类型),实现数 阅读全文
posted @ 2020-04-08 22:07 cs_wu 阅读(725) 评论(0) 推荐(0) 编辑
摘要: 今天在写代码,声明了一个vector<char*>后,把字符串一个一个插入其中,但是最后输出的结果却是vector容器中存放的都是最后一个插入的数据。插入 10条数据,最后输出的是把最后一条数据输出了10次。这是为什么? 有问题的代码如下: #include<iostream> #include<v 阅读全文
posted @ 2020-04-01 23:20 cs_wu 阅读(1376) 评论(0) 推荐(0) 编辑
上一页 1 2 3 4 5 6 ··· 23 下一页